What is Hyperhidrosis Botox?
Hyperhidrosis is a medical condition that causes abnormal, uncontrollable sweating. It often affects the armpits, hands, feet, and forehead. Botox — short for botulinum toxin — is injected into the skin to block the nerve signals that trigger sweat glands. The result is a dramatic reduction in sweating that lasts for several months.
- Non-surgical: No cuts, no scars, and no general anesthesia needed
- Fast treatment: The procedure takes only 20 to 40 minutes
- Proven results: Clinical studies show Botox reduces sweating by up to 87% in treated areas
Types of Hyperhidrosis Botox Offered in Korea
Korean clinics offer Botox for excessive sweating in several key areas of the body. Each area is priced and treated separately. Many of Seoul’s leading skincare seoul facilities specialize in these targeted treatments with precision techniques.
- Axillary (Underarm) Botox: The most requested type. Stops underarm sweating and odor. Ideal for people who struggle with sweat stains or body odor even after using antiperspirant.
- Palmar (Hand) Botox: Treats sweaty palms, which can interfere with handshakes, typing, and daily tasks. Slightly more sensitive during injection but very effective.
- Plantar (Foot) Botox: Reduces sweating on the soles of the feet, helping with odor and discomfort inside shoes.
- Facial and Scalp Botox: Targets sweating on the forehead or scalp, which can cause makeup to run or hair to stay wet throughout the day.

Cost of Hyperhidrosis Botox in Korea
Prices vary depending on the treatment area and the amount of Botox used. Below are typical price ranges you can expect at reputable Seoul clinics.
- Underarm Botox (both sides): ₩300,000 – ₩500,000 (approximately $220 – $370 USD)
- Hand Botox (both hands): ₩400,000 – ₩600,000 (approximately $295 – $445 USD)
- Foot Botox (both feet): ₩400,000 – ₩650,000 (approximately $295 – $480 USD)
- Facial or Scalp Botox: ₩250,000 – ₩450,000 (approximately $185 – $335 USD)
For comparison, underarm Botox in the United States typically costs between $1,000 and $1,500 USD. Korea offers the same quality treatment for significantly less. What to Expect During and After
Before the injections, your doctor will mark the treatment area and may apply a numbing cream to keep you comfortable. The Botox is then injected in a grid pattern across the skin using a very fine needle. Most patients describe the feeling as a light pinching sensation.
After the treatment, you can return to your normal activities right away. There is no downtime. Some patients notice mild redness or small bumps at the injection sites, but these usually disappear within a few hours. You should avoid intense exercise, saunas, and alcohol for 24 hours after the procedure. Follow-up and Results
You will start to notice less sweating within three to five days. Full results typically appear after one to two weeks. The effects last between four and twelve months, depending on the area treated and your body’s response to the Botox.
Most patients return for a repeat treatment once or twice a year to maintain results. Many clinics in Korea offer loyalty pricing for returning patients. Your doctor will advise you on the best schedule based on how your body responds.
